A violent altercation at a North Carolina high school has ended in tragedy. One student was killed and another injured in a stabbing on Tuesday. The incident occurred at North Forsyth High School in Winston-Salem.
Authorities were called to the scene shortly after 11 a.m. The Forsyth County Sheriff’s Office confirmed the death. The community is now grappling with the shock and aftermath of the violence.
Authorities Respond to “Worst Nightmare” School Incident
Forsyth County Sheriff Bobby Kimbrough addressed the media. He stated deputies responded to an altercation between two students. Sheriff Kimbrough confirmed there was a loss of life but did not take questions.
Superintendent Don Phipps sent an email to families. He confirmed one student died and another was hurt. Phipps, who started his job just last week, called it the worst nightmare for any educator.
The injured student was treated at a hospital. According to sheriff’s office spokesperson Krista Karcher, that student was later released. The school district has announced that the high school will be closed on Wednesday.
Community and Official Reactions to the Stabbing
Crisis support teams will be available for staff and students. The district is prioritizing mental health resources following the trauma. This planning is for when the school community returns.
North Carolina Governor Josh Stein reacted on social media. He called the event shocking and horrible. Governor Stein stated he was praying for all students and their loved ones affected by the violence.
The investigation remains active and ongoing. No information about potential charges has been released publicly. Law enforcement continues to gather details about the circumstances leading to the stabbing.
